Book Description

May 5, 1999
Explore the roots of the controversial word, CHICANO, in this dramatically illustrated epic peom. Dr. Jimenez, author and educator, encapsulates the disillusionment and discouragement of Native Americans. But, not just those labeled Indians, it is also about the range of Spanish speaking ones labeled Chicano, Hispanic, Latino, whatever.

If it is of any relevance to understand what makes the "Latino" mind tick, Mucho Boleto Pero No Tren provides the reader with a Chicano voice that is so clear that the written text becomes a magic carpet into the Chicano/Mestizo psyche within the U.S. context. This book is for the enlightened politicians of the world. If you want to know how important circumstances and history shaped the collective mind of a people, then experience their reality through this book. With the use emotionally charged photos and an intertwining of four languages (English, Spanish, Native American and Southwest slang), delivery of the verbal experiences is enhanced to a haunting, defining crescendo. Award-winning photographers Ted Sahl and John G. Rodriguez contribute staring visual images. A glossary of terms broaden the understanding of words and terms.

About the Author

Dr. Randall C. Jimenez, Associate Professor and Graduate Adviser, Mexican-American Studies at San Jose State University, holds a doctorate degree in Education from University of California Berkeley, has instructed in colleges, as well as, taught public and parochial schools, in addition to directing several community agencies. An active historian, he has participated in archeo-logical digs in Mexico and California. Among his published works are El Alma Chicano, a series of short stories, and The Voices of Matatlan, a novel.
